Robotic Vacuums

Some models use infrared sensors, similar to those used in self-driving vehicles to create a virtual map. Others employ camera-based sensors that identify objects and avoid them. These sensors let you choose an area of your house for cleaning using the on-board controls or a smartphone app. A few models even allow you to control the robot with voice commands. You can choose to vacuum one room or even send it to encircle the walls to do a perimeter clean.

Robotic Floor Mop

If you want to take a break from the hassle of keep your floors clean, a robot mop is your best bet. These machines will scrub your floors of wood and tile between deep cleaning sessions and will keep dirt, pet hair, and other debris away. They work on all sealed hard flooring, including vinyl, laminate, and hardwood. The majority of robot mops can be set to clean at specific times, and you can use the app to adjust cleaning options, make an agenda or keep track of when the mop requires maintenance such as a filter change.

Robotic floor mops typically require an additional tank of water for mopping. This can be difficult to refill and empty as the pads get dirty. Look for a model that has a self-emptying dock or one that can be easily emptyable by hand when needed.

Some models also vacuum. However, you might have to empty the bin after each cleaning session, unless they have self-emptying platforms. If your floors are especially dusty, letting the robot sweep first, then mop might produce better results.

Most robot mops only require tap water, but some allow you to add a cleaning solution into the tank to provide extra cleaning. It is essential to use only cleaning solutions recommended by the manufacturer, since using unauthorized ones can cause damage to the machine or invalidate its warranty.

In addition to allowing you to start and stop the bot, some apps also allow you to create an outline of your home and set up virtual barriers and no-go zones. Some will even inform you when the battery is running low and the mop has to be washed.
